The climate of Chibombo
Chibombo, situated in
Zambia, is dominated primarily by a Humid subtropical, dry winter climate, as categorized by the Köppen climate classification system. Termed as a 'Cwa' climate type, it is characterized by significant rainfall in summers and cooler, drier winters. This substantial contrast in weather conditions is experienced throughout the varied months of the year.
The high temperatures manifest a relatively steady pattern, hovering between 23.3°C (73.9°F) and 33.1°C (91.6°F). The hottest periods typically occur from
September to
November, with temperatures peaking at 33.1°C (91.6°F). The cooler months from
June to
August see the mercury drop to its annual lows, around 23.3°C (73.9°F). Nightly minimum temperatures range from 10.7°C (51.3°F) to 19.2°C (66.6°F), with the coldest nights typically in
July and the warmest in November.
Rainfall presents a more stark disparity. The wettest period, from
January to
February with rainfall from 166mm (6.54") to 206mm (8.11"), experiences more than fifty times the rainfall of the dryest period from
May to August, with virtually no rainfall recorded. The annual trend presents a high number of rainfall days initially, around 27.6 days in January, which decline subsequently, reaching a minimum of 0.2 days by July and August. The rain-laden clouds give way to increasingly clear skies during these months, with cloud covers dropping to lows of 3% by September.
The average day length doesn't vary significantly, lying between 11.3 hours to 13 hours. The shortest days are usually in June, while the longest are seen in
December. A similar pattern is there for sunshine with the sunniest days in
October and the gloomiest in January. The trend in wind speed shows an increase from January, peaking at 15.2km/h (9.4mph) in September, and then a gradual decrease thereafter.
The unique feature of Chibombo’s climate is the drastic pitch from the heavy rainfall in the initial months of the year to practically no rainfall from May to August.

Spring weather in Chibombo
Spring in
Chibombo, extending from
September to
November, welcomes an escalation in temperatures, rising from 27.2°C (81°F) to 33.1°C (91.6°F). The nights remain moderately warm, with temperatures fluctuating between 13.5°C (56.3°F) and 19.2°C (66.6°F). Rainfall is minimal, from 0mm (0") to 4mm (0.16"), and the relative humidity is at its lowest, around 33%. The daylight duration increases slightly from 12 hours to 12.8 hours.
Summer weather in Chibombo
The summer season in
Chibombo, from
December to
February, is marked by downpours. Rainfall increases drastically from 184mm (7.24") to a peak of 206mm (8.11"), while the relative humidity increases within the range of 86% and 88%. Daytime temperatures maintain the high warmth, from 25.8°C (78.4°F) to 27.2°C (81°F). Nightly lows vary from 17.8°C (64°F) to 18.5°C (65.3°F).
Autumn weather in Chibombo
Autumn months, between
March and
May, see a significant reduction in rainfall, from 87mm (3.43") to just 2mm (0.08"). A simultaneous drop in humidity sees the scale dip below 70%, reaching a level of 68%. The temperatures start to cool down from 25.3°C (77.5°F) to 23.3°C (73.9°F). Nightly temperatures also decrease, recording as low as 12.9°C (55.2°F).
Winter weather in Chibombo
Winter in
Chibombo, from
June to
August, is the driest period, recording rainfall as low as 1mm (0.04"). Temperature readings drop to annual lows of 23.3°C (73.9°F) and nightly temperatures to 10.7°C (51.3°F). The humidity stays low, fluctuating slightly between 58% and 43%. The skies remain mostly clear with a monthly average cloud cover as low as 6%, making the winter days not just long, but sunny.
